Features and Specifications:

AMD FX-Series FX 6100 3.3 GHz Six-Core Six-Thread CPU Processor FD6100WMW6KGU Socket AM3+
  1. Six-Core Architecture: The FX 6100 features a multi-core design, boasting six processing cores that enable efficient parallelization of tasks, resulting in faster performance.
  2. 3.3 GHz Clock Speed: The processor operates at a base clock speed of 3.3 GHz, providing ample speed for daily computing activities and demanding applications.
  3. 8 MB L3 Cache: The large L3 cache ensures quick access to frequently used data, reducing latency and improving overall performance.
  4. 6 MB L2 Cache: The L2 cache further enhances the processor’s responsiveness by storing frequently accessed data closer to the processing cores.
  5. Support for DDR3 Memory: The FX 6100 supports up to 16GB of DDR3 memory, allowing for smooth multitasking and handling memory-intensive applications.
  6. Socket Compatibility: The processor is designed for Socket AM3+ motherboards, offering compatibility with a wide range of platforms.
  7. Unlocked Multiplier: The unlocked multiplier enables enthusiasts to overclock the processor for even higher performance, unlocking its full potential.

Frequently Asked Questions:

  1. Is the FX 6100 still relevant today?
    Yes, despite its age, the FX 6100 remains a capable processor for basic computing tasks, casual gaming, and productivity applications.

  2. Is the FX 6100 suitable for overclocking?
    Yes, the FX 6100 has an unlocked multiplier, allowing users to overclock it for improved performance. However, it is recommended to have a compatible motherboard and adequate cooling to ensure stability.

  3. What is the power consumption of the FX 6100?
    The FX 6100 has a default TDP of 95W, which is relatively high compared to modern processors. It is essential to pair it with a suitable cooling solution for optimal performance and longevity.
